There's a strong argument to be made that Hollywood should spend less time remaking great, timeless movies than interesting, rough-around-the-edges films that didn't quite hit their full potential.

And so, it's tough not to be at least mildly intrigued by the impending remake of Enemy Mine - a 1985 sci-fi film starring Dennis Quaid and Louis Gossett Jr. as a human and alien respectively, who end up stranded on a hostile planet and forced to work together to survive.

Though it flopped at the box office and received mixed critical reviews, Enemy Mine has remained a cult fave with sci-fi fans, and last June a remake was unexpectedly announced.

The big hook, however, is that the remake is being written by Terry Matalas, who received considerable acclaim for his work on the 12 Monkeys TV series and the third season of Star Trek: Picard.

The latter is especially noteworthy given that an episode of Star Trek: The Next Generation, "The Enemy," was even heavily inspired by Enemy Mine. 

Above all else, it's easy to see how Matalas, a smart writer of contemporary sci-fi, could give Enemy Mine a worthy modern update.

Now, we just need to see who ends up playing the two leads.
